The growth of populism in the EU member states, as a large-scale internal challenge to the European integration project, has a projection on foreign policy of both national states and the European ...Union. The EU foreign policy, towards Russia, is the area where the deviation of populist programs and strategies from the positions of the mainstream is most clearly manifested. In this regard, it is necessary to determine the foreign policy orientations of the populist radical right parties of the EU member states regarding the EU foreign policy, towards Russia, and opportunities for their synchronization. The main conclusion of this research is that populist foreign policy orientations highlight the internal heterogeneity of the populist phenomenon. Populism in power and in opposition does not have the capacity to change the EU's foreign policy towards Russia. The nature of populism as an ideology, the instrumental use by right populists of the 'theme of Russia' for 'internal consumption' and their mainstreaming in power are a significant barrier to the real challenge of the EU policy towards Russia.

Laws governing the sorption of quinoline derivatives on hypercrosslinked polystyrene are studied under conditions of reverse-phase high-performance liquid chromatography. Factors of sorbate retention ...at different concentrations of acetonitrile in the eluent are determined. An analysis is performed of the dependences of variation in the enthalpy of sorption and the entropy term of the temperature dependence of the retention factor on the content of the organic component in the eluent for the studied compounds.

Objective
: to evaluate the possibilities of dynamic scintigraphy for the diagnosis of esophageal dysmotility (ED) and gastroesophageal reflux (GER) in patients with systemic sclerosis (SS).
Material ...and methods
. The study group included 77 patients with established SS of different disease duration (from several months to 30 years) who underwent Technephyt 99mTc dynamic esophageal scintigraphy using two-stage protocol. During the first stage, the esophageal transport function was evaluated; during the second stage, the presence and severity of GER were assessed. Scans were analyzed using visual assessment, quantitative estimation of time/activity curves, and a proposed three-point scale for evaluating ED and GER severity. The control group consisted of 19 practically healthy individuals who underwent a routine examination to exclude digestive system and gastrointestinal tract diseases, the algorithm of which included dynamic scintigraphy.
Results
. ED was found in 74 of 77 patients (96%). According to three-point scale, severe ED (3 points) was registrated in 41 (55%) patients, moderate ED (2 points) in 15 (21%), and mild ED in 18 (24%). GER was diagnosed in 35 of 77 cases (45%): mild GER in 13 (37%), moderate GER (2 points) in 22 (63%), and none of the patients was found to have severe GER (3 points). A significant relationship between the presence of GER and the severity of ED was not obtained, but a direct correlation was established between ED and GER severity.
Conclusion
. Most SS patients demonstrated ED of varying severity associated with mild and moderate GER in nearly 45% of the cases. The study results confirm the practical significance of dynamic scintigraphy for assessing the esophageal transport function and GER in SS patients.
To evaluate the impact of single-stage selective arterial catheterizations during X-ray endovascular interventions to reduce obtained radiation doses in the treatment of patients.
X-ray endovascular ...interventions were carried out in the operating room equipped with a flat detector digital angiography system (Axiom Artis dTA, Siemens Medical System). The impact of single-stage selective arterial catheterization procedures was analyzed during endovascular interventions for coronary heart disease and uterine myomas on the time course of changes in the collective effective radiation doses for patients in the period 2013 to 2015.
Analysis of the findings showed that single-stage selective coronary angiography using a universal (multipurpose) radial coronary catheter and single-stage X-ray endovascular uterine artery embolization techniques could reduce collective effective doses for patients from 5.86 persons-Sv in 2013 to 1.6 persons-Sv in 2015.
Different single-stage selective catheterization procedures used during endovascular interventions into the coronary and uterine arteries can reduce radiation doses for patients.
Determination of the diagnostic capabilities of magnetic resonance imaging of the uterus and its appendages (MRHSG) on devices with the induction of the magnetic field 3 Tesla (T) as an alternative ...to the classic X-ray hysterosalpingography, accompanied by a significant radiation dose to the patient.
During the period from April 2015 to February 2016 12 MRHSG was conducted using magnetic resonance imaging apparatus Verio Magnetom 3T, Siemens company (Diagnostic Center "BarsMed", Kazan, Russia). We used neutral and not giving adverse reactions contrast agent – carbon dioxide. The pelvic organs – the uterus and fallopian tubes – represent the zone of interest.
Analysis of the data showed that MRHSG on the apparatus with the induction of the magnetic field of 3 T is a highly informative method in the diagnosis of tubal patency, allowing fully assess the state of the pelvic organs on the whole and identify pathology.
The absence of radiation exposure and contraindications associated with intolerance to iodinated contrast agents and other side effects differs MRHSG from the traditional X-ray method and makes MRHSG to be an alternative secure method of diagnosis, which has a number of advantages described in the article.
MRHSG on the apparatus with the induction of the magnetic field of 3 T in diagnosis of obstruction of the fallopian tubes and the visualization of the uterus and appendages diseases can be optimal and safe alternative to the X-ray hysterosalpingography, which accompanied with radiation exposure and is a number of side effects.
Choosing a treatment option for uterine fibroids is today one of the most relevant problems in gynecological practice. Thanks to the success of modern medicine and the increased level of the ...population’s culture, female patients seek medical help without waiting for the tumor to acquire significant sizes. However, in practice, there are cases when fibroids reach gigantic sizes. Hysterectomy is a traditional approach to treating uterine fibroids of these sizes according to the current clinical guidelines. The introduction of new high-tech treatments, such as uterine artery embolization, has led to a revision of radical surgery, by giving preference to alternative approaches especially in cases where the patient desires to preserve the reproductive organ. The paper describes a clinical case that confirms an individual approach to choosing a treatment option towards organ-sparing surgery for giant uterine fibroids. The use of endovascular embolization of the uterine arteries as a treatment for giant uterine fibroids is shown to be justified as an organ-sparing surgery if the patient desires to preserve reproductive function.
The paper describes a clinical case of successfully applying a transradial access during mechanical thrombus extraction in a patient in the acutest stage of ischemic stroke with a congenital ...anatomical feature (the left common carotid artery and brachiocephalic trunk with the common ostium from the aortic arch).X-ray endovascular interventions were performed in an operating room equipped with a digital angiographic unit including an Axiom Artis dTA flat detector (Siemens Medical System).Mechanical recanalization for acute occlusion of the M2 segment of the left middle cerebral artery (MCA) was carried out using a right radial access into and catheterization of the left internal carotid artery. A stent retriever was inserted into the occlusion area through a microcatheter and was opened. Double thrombus extraction from the left MCA was made using the stent retriever to restore TICI 2B blood flow. There were no signs of dissection, thrombosis, or distal thromboembolism.
